elimination method really confuses me.
solve by elimination method
5r -3s = 17
3r + 5s =17
A. solution is ______ (ordered pair, integer or fraction)
B. Infinitely many
C. No Solution

try to get either the x or the y coefficients to be alike
in this case I will get the y's to have a 15 in front
so multiply the first by 5 and the second by 3 to get
25r - 15s = 85
9r + 15s = 51
add them
34r = 136
r = 136/34 = 4
back in second, (or first)
3(4) + 5s = 17
12 + 5s = 17
5s = 5
s = 1
